Output e60e5937643a6e84326e21d71d8eb0ff60d2a8a8038ab929dd3f445e3d293127:12

value
20131863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fffecc905bf90009953d880aa3d0af671236de OP_EQUAL
address
MWscWSnx3xrVqRUXN3Sn1ge52UErb2Zevz
transaction
e60e5937643a6e84326e21d71d8eb0ff60d2a8a8038ab929dd3f445e3d293127
spent
true